SAPR2000: Достойное продолжение легенды

Эх, а вот лет 10 назад, когда появлялись первые версии SAPR2000, мы и представить не могли, куда все это дело двинется. Сейчас, конечно, всё стало гораздо сложнее и одновременно проще. Недавно решил поковырять последнюю версию, посмотреть что там нового для строительных расчетов, и впечатления у меня остались, в общем-то, положительные

Что сразу бросается в глаза — это интерфейс. Он стал куда дружелюбнее, хотя всё еще чувствуется некоторая тяжеловесность, свойственная программам такого уровня. Моделировать сложные проектирование конструкций теперь можно без таких мучений, как раньше. Новые инструменты для задания нагрузок и граничных условий, например, значительно ускоряют процесс. Помню, как раньше на каждую мелочь макросы писали или вручную вбивали, чтоб не сойти с ума.

Из того, что понравилось:

  • Улучшенная визуализация результатов расчетов. Теперь гораздо нагляднее видно, где что трещит и гнется.
  • Больше возможностей для интеграции с другими программами. Это прямо спасение для комплексного инженерные расчеты.
  • Расширенные библиотеки конечных элементов и материалов.

Теперь о минусах, куда без них:

  • Все ещё бывают странные ошибки, которые приходится долго искать. Ну, сами понимаете, такое программное обеспечение для проектирования просто не бывает идеальным.
  • Цена. Это, конечно, отдельная песня. Для небольшой конторы или фрилансера – дороговато, имхо.

В целом, SAPR2000 остаётся мощным инструментом. Если сравнивать с тем, что было лет 15 назад, прогресс колоссальный. Конечно, порог вхождения все еще высок, но тот, кто освоит, получит в руки действительно серьёзную силу для работы.

Подробнее

Продвинутые настройки SAP R2000 для точных строительных расчетов

Рад поделиться опытом работы с SAP R2000, особенно в части оптимизации для получения наиболее точных результатов при проектировании конструкций. Многие упираются в базовые настройки, но скрытый потенциал программы позволяет значительно улучшить качество инженерных расчетов.

  • Разбиение конечных элементов. Не стоит полагаться на автоматическое разбиение. Для критических зон, таких как узлы соединений или участки с концентрацией напряжений, вручную задавайте более мелкие элементы. Это повышает точность локально. По моим замерам, увеличение плотности сетки в 1.5 раза в таких зонах снижало погрешность на 8-12%.
  • Выбор моделей материалов. Для нелинейных расчетов, особенно при работе с железобетонными конструкциями, критически важно правильно выбрать модель материала. Использование стандартных моделей без учета специфики материала (например, ползучести или усадки) может привести к значительным искажениям. Рекомендую изучить библиотеку SAP R2000 и, при необходимости, создавать собственные модели, соответствующие экспериментальным данным.
  • Постановка граничных условий. Часто ошибки кроются именно здесь. Убедитесь, что граничные условия моделируют реальное опирание конструкции. Неправильно заданные шарниры или жесткие заделки — прямой путь к неверным результатам. Проверяйте каждую степень свободы
  • Параметры расчета. Для нелинейных анализов обращайте внимание на шаги расчета и критерии сходимости. Слишком большие шаги могут привести к потере точности или даже к срыву расчета. Ну и конечно, не забывайте про сходимость, она — ваш индикатор корректности.

Это базовые, но крайне важные моменты. Правильная настройка — половина успеха в любом проекте, будь то проектирование конструкций или сложные строительные расчеты.

Подробнее

Припомнил тут один случай с...

Эх, а вот лет 10 назад, когда только начинал по-настоящему вникать в тонкости строительных расчетов, довелось мне столкнуться с одной задачкой, которая до сих пор перед глазами стоит. Дело было так: разрабатывали мы проект реконструкции старого заводского цеха, где нужно было учесть нагрузку от нового производственного оборудования. Заказчик, как водится, торопил, а сроки поджимали.

Взялся я за SAPR2000, конечно. Вроде бы ничего сложного, модель создал, нагрузки приложил, запускаю расчет. И тут – бац! – программа выдает какие-то совершенно дикие перемещения и напряжения, которые ну никак не укладывались в логику. Я сначала думал – ошибка в модели, где-то там, в процессе проектирования конструкций, напутал. Проверил все много раз, каждую балку, каждую опору. Все вроде бы правильно.

Потом начал грешить на версию программы. Помню, помню, эти старые версии иногда чудили безбожно. Перебрал несколько вариантов, результат тот же. Уже начал нервничать, ведь скоро сдавать отчет, а тут такое. Решил остановиться и спокойно разобраться. Отвлекся, попил чаю, потом снова вернулся к модели. И тут, как осенило! Оказалось, что я в одном месте, при задании жесткости шарниров, перепутал единицы измерения. Там ведь были не просто шарниры, а опоры с определенной податливостью, и я, уставший от долгих инженерных расчетов, по невнимательности ввел значение в метрах вместо миллиметров.

Вот такая вот мелочь, казалось бы, а результат – совершенно неадекватный. Перезапустил расчет с правильными данными, и все встало на свои места. Перемещения стали адекватными, напряжения в пределах нормы. Получил я тогда хороший урок: даже в самом продвинутом программном обеспечении для проектирования, как SAPR2000, человеческий фактор остается решающим. Теперь всегда, когда работаю со сложными моделями, делаю двойную, а то и тройную проверку всех исходных данных. Раньше, конечно, и без таких мощных программ обходились, вручную считали, но это совсем другая история ;)

Подробнее

SAPR2000: гений или монстр для инженера?

Ну вот, тут все так бурно обсуждают SAPR2000, что прям захотелось свои пять копеек вставить. Имхо, эта прога, конечно, мощь, но иногда кажется что она больше для себя, чем для человека. Серьезно, столько кнопок, столько настроек, что пока разберешься, половина проекта уже сделана вручную. Хотя, конечно, если речь заходит про сложные строительные расчеты и уникальное проектирование конструкций, тут ей равных мало

Вот я, например, смотрю на все эти возможности и думаю: а точно ли мне вот это вот все нужно для каждой задачи? Или иногда этот аппарат overkill? Может, для стандартных задач типа балки посчитать или ферму загнать, есть что-то попроще и быстрее, чтобы мозг себе не выносить? Кароч, вопрос к вам: вы тоже так заморачиваетесь с настройками SAPR2000, или я один такой?

Подробнее

Помню, как SAPR2000 чуть не уложил меня в больницу...

Ахах, чуваки, сегодня вспомнил один случай, аж в дрожь бросило. Это было лет пять назад, еще когда только-только вникал во все тонкости строительных расчетов с помощью SAPR2000. Задача стояла — посчитать нагрузку на перекрытия в одном старом здании, там реконструкция намечалась. Ну, я, как юный энтузиаст, решил, что сделаю все максимально точно, просто до микрона!

Нарисовал модельку, задал все материалы, нагрузки, опоры. Короче, копнул так глубоко, что, кажется, сам SAPR2000 начал шутить надо мной. И вот, запускаю расчет. Процессор дымится, пальцы стучат по столу в предвкушении. И тут… сообщение об ошибке. Ну, фигня, думаю, бывает. Захожу в отчет, а там такое! Какие-то экстремальные перемещения, напряжения зашкаливают далеко за пределы разумного. В общем, по всем раскладам, здание должно было просто сложиться, как карточный домик, еще до начала реконструкции.

Я в шоке, конечно. Начал перепроверять все. Открыл другие программы для строительных расчетов, чтобы сравнить. Сводил все вручную по некоторым участкам. Тоже самое! Думаю, ну все, это конец моей карьере инженера. Уже начал думать, как бы мне сказать заказчику, что его здание — это реально бомба замедленного действия. Готовился к худшему

Потом, уже на холодную голову, решил еще раз пройтись по входным данным. И тут, друзья, я обнаружил тот самый нюанс! Оказалось, что при задании жесткости шарнирного соединения, я случайно перепутал единицы измерения. Вместо нужных кН*м, там стояли кН*мм. Вот такая мелочь! Компьютер-то все сделал правильно, просто я ему дал совершенно дурацкие исходные данные. Если бы не это, я бы, наверное, поседел раньше времени. Так что, имхо, даже с самым мощным софтом, вроде SAPR2000, надо быть предельно внимательным к деталям, особенно в проектировании конструкций.

Подробнее

SAPR2000 и эти долбаные консоли!

Ну вот опять двадцать пять. Работаю с SAPR2000, проектирую очередную железобетонную конструкцию, и эти консоли... Ну как так можно, а? Вроде всё по методичке, нагрузки задал, узлы проверил, а он выдает какой-то дикий перерасход арматуры, будто я там не балку считаю, а целый мост. Чего только не пробовал: и схему нагружения менял, и шаг армирования подбирал, и даже модель пересоздавал с нуля — толку ноль. Уже второй день бьюсь, а задача висит. Может, кто-то сталкивался с подобным в строительных расчетах? Поделитесь опытом, а то уже руки опускаются.

Подробнее

Гайд по ускорению расчетов в SAPR2000: 5 фишек из практики

Народ, привет! Решил запилить гайд по тому, как ускорить жизнь себе и SAPR2000, особенно когда модель сложная или надо быстро проверить кучу вариантов. Сам периодически сталкиваюсь с тем, что расчеты затягиваются, а сроки горят, так что эти советы реально выручают. Короче, погнали!

  • Упрощайте геометрию, где только можно Ну типа если у вас сложная кривая стена, а она не несет особой нагрузки, можно ее аппроксимировать прямой или ломаной. SAPR2000 не любит излишнюю детализацию, которая не влияет на конечный результат. Это касается и мелких элементов, которые можно объединить в более крупные.
  • Правильно выбирайте тип конечных элементов. Не надо везде пихать 3D-твердотельные элементы, если задача решается 2D или даже стержневыми. Для балок и ферм — стержни, для плит и стен — оболочки. Это кардинально снижает количество узлов и, соответсвенно, время расчета. Конечно, для сложных строительных расчетов надо быть уверенным, что выбранный тип КЭ адекватно передает напряжения.
  • Разбивайте большие модели на части Если у вас огромный комплекс, который долго считается, попробуйте выделить из него ключевые участки и посчитать их отдельно. Потом результаты можно будет использовать как граничные условия для остальной части. Это сильно ускоряет первичный анализ и выявление проблемных зон.
  • Грамотно задавайте нагрузки. Не надо задавать все нагрузки в одном расчете, если это не требуется. Можно разбить на группы: постоянные, временные, особые. SAPR2000 позволит потом комбинировать их по нужным нормам. Это не столько ускоряет сам расчет, сколько упрощает управление и анализ результатов, ну и иногда позволяет не пересчитывать все подряд
  • Используйте функцию «Analysis Options» с умом. Там есть настройки, которые влияют на точность и скорость. Например, можно уменьшить количество шагов интегрирования или изменить критерии сходимости, если вам не нужна супер-высокая точность. Но тут осторожно, это уже ближе к инженерным расчетам, где цена ошибки высока.

В общем, это такие базовые вещи, но если их не делать, то потом удивляться, почему ваш программный комплекс SAPR2000 так долго думает, не стоит. Надеюсь, кому-то пригодится! Всем быстрых и точных расчетов! ;)

Подробнее

Специфические задачи в SAPR2000: как решать нестандартные кейсы

Привет, коллеги! Хочу поделиться опытом решения специфических задач в SAPR2000. Иногда стандартных настроек недостаточно, и приходится искать нестандартные решения. Вот несколько советов:

  1. Используйте нестандартные типы элементов. Иногда приходится моделировать элементы, которых нет в стандартном наборе.
  2. Настраивайте пользовательские нагрузки. Если стандартных нагрузок не хватает, создавайте свои.
  3. Глубоко изучайте документацию. В ней часто можно найти ответы на самые сложные вопросы.
  4. Не бойтесь экспериментировать. Иногда только опытным путем можно найти оптимальное решение.

Не забывайте, что SAPR2000 — это мощный инструмент, который позволяет решать самые разные задачи. Главное — не бояться и пробовать!

Подробнее

Проблема совместимости: SAPR2000 и мои нервы!

Друзья, помогите! Столкнулся с проблемой, которая просто выводит из себя. Пытаюсь открыть модель, созданную в более ранней версии SAPR2000, в новой — и ничего не получается!

Вылетают ошибки, модель либо не открывается вообще, либо отображается некорректно. Перепробовал кучу способов, пытался конвертировать, но все бесполезно. Что делать?

Может, кто-то сталкивался с подобным? Посоветуйте, пожалуйста, как решить эту проблему! Уже устал тратить время на эти танцы с бубном.

Подробнее

История о том, как я чуть не завалил проект из-за SAPR2000...

Было это в самом начале моей карьеры, когда я только начинал осваивать SAPR2000. Задание — спроектировать небольшое одноэтажное здание. Ну, я, как обычно, сел за компьютер, начал моделировать, считать... Короче, все шло вроде неплохо.

Наконец, расчет завершен, я получаю результаты и… ошибка. Сначала я не придал значения, исправил пару мелочей и запустил расчет заново. Опять ошибка! Короче, я потратил несколько дней, но так и не смог понять, что не так. Модель вроде бы правильная, нагрузки рассчитаны верно, а программа твердит свое...

В итоге, я обратился за помощью к более опытному коллеге. Оказалось, я просто забыл учесть один маленький нюанс при задании нагрузок — это и было причиной всех бед. Урок усвоил на всю жизнь! С тех пор всегда проверяю все по сто раз.

Подробнее